Java + DevOps Engineer
N-ix
Job Summary
This role is for a Java + DevOps Engineer to join a team working with an American global e-commerce leader. The customer's platform connects millions of sellers and buyers worldwide. The engineer will monitor, analyze, and enhance over 200 distributed microservices, manage incident response, and ensure operational excellence. Key responsibilities include delivering DevOps outcomes, collaborating on monitoring and automation frameworks, and developing high-availability Java backend applications.
Must Have
- Monitor, analyze, and enhance the health of 200+ distributed microservices
- Own incident response and drive operational excellence as a member of our 24/7 SRE on-call rotation
- Deliver key DevOps outcomes—CVEs, SWUs, software upgrades, automated failover, resilience engineering, robust security design, and infrastructure improvements
- Collaborate cross-functionally to design, implement, and maintain monitoring, alerting, and automation frameworks
- Build standardized tooling and practices supporting rapid recovery, continuous improvement, and compliance
- Develop in Java for backend, including debugging, optimizing, and maintaining high-availability server-side applications and distributed systems
- 4+ years of extensive Java development experience
- 3-4 years hands-on expertise with cloud infrastructure (AWS, GCP or Azure), containers and orchestration, CI/CD, monitoring stacks, automation
- Strong experience in Site Reliability Engineering, DevOps, or Production Operations
- Solid understanding of incident management, reliability engineering, and microservice architectures
- Willingness to participate in a rotating 24/7 on call schedule
- Excellent problem-solving, communication, and teamwork skills
- Upper-Intermediate/Advanced English level
Good to Have
- Background in security best practices, system resilience, and disaster recovery is a plus
Perks & Benefits
- Flexible working format - remote, office-based or flexible
- A competitive salary and good compensation package
- Personalized career growth
- Professional development tools (mentorship program, tech talks and trainings, centers of excellence, and more)
- Active tech communities with regular knowledge sharing
- Education reimbursement
- Memorable anniversary presents
- Corporate events and team buildings
- Other location-specific benefits
Job Description
Project:
American multinational e-commerce company
We are looking for talented Java + DevOps Engineer to join our team.
Our California-based customer is an American global e-commerce leader, one of the most popular and successful websites on the Internet. It provides platform services by connecting millions of sellers and buyers in more than 190 markets around the world.
Responsibilities:
- Monitor, analyze, and enhance the health of 200+ distributed microservices.
- Own incident response and drive operational excellence as a member of our 24/7 SRE on-call rotation, ensuring uptime and meeting strict SLAs.
- Deliver key DevOps outcomes—CVEs, SWUs, software upgrades, automated failover, resilience engineering, robust security design, and infrastructure improvements.
- Collaborate cross-functionally to design, implement, and maintain monitoring, alerting, and automation frameworks.
- Build standardized tooling and practices supporting rapid recovery, continuous improvement, and compliance.
- Develop in Java for backend, including debugging, optimizing, and maintaining high-availability server-side applications and distributed systems.
Requirements:
- 4+ years of extensive Java development experience
- 3-4 years hands-on expertise with cloud infrastructure (AWS, GCP or Azure), containers and orchestration, CI/CD, monitoring stacks, automation
- Strong experience in Site Reliability Engineering, DevOps, or Production Operations—preferably supporting large-scale systems
- Solid understanding of incident management, reliability engineering, and microservice architectures
- Background in security best practices, system resilience, and disaster recovery is a plus
- Willingness to participate in a rotating 24/7 on call schedule
- Excellent problem-solving, communication, and teamwork skills
- Upper-Intermediate/Advanced English level (there will be a lot of communication with the client)
We offer*:
- Flexible working format - remote, office-based or flexible
- A competitive salary and good compensation package
- Personalized career growth
- Professional development tools (mentorship program, tech talks and trainings, centers of excellence, and more)
- Active tech communities with regular knowledge sharing
- Education reimbursement
- Memorable anniversary presents
- Corporate events and team buildings
- Other location-specific benefits
*not applicable for freelancers